
F.Kep held a Socialization for New Student Admissions for the RPL Bachelor of Nursing, RPL Bachelor of Physiotherapy, Master of Nursing and Medical Surgical Nursing Specialist Education Programs. Socialization activities were carried out in parallel on (27/01 – 02/02).

This activity was carried out offline in several districts/cities, including Tenriawaru Bone Regional Hospital, Syekh Yusuf Gowa Regional Hospital, Padjonga Takalar Regional Hospital, Bantaeng Health Service Hall, H. Andi Sulthan Daeng Radja Bulukumba Regional Hospital, dr. Hasri Ainun Habibie Pare-Pare, Batara Guru Luwu Regional Hospital and Online Zoom Meeting Socialization, namely Kab. Pohuwatu Province Gorontalo and Socialization open to the Public. Those involved in the activity were the Dean, Deputy Dean, KPS, KTU and Head of Subdivision.
The Dean of F.Kep (Prof. Dr. Ariyanti Saleh, S.Kp., M.Si) expressed his thanks for their participation and cooperation to the RSUD leaders, the PPNI Chair and the PPNI DPD because they had been given the opportunity to provide socialization on the educational programs available at Nursing faculty.

“This activity is an opportunity for the Faculty of Nursing to socialize several new programs and also several policy changes to carry out further studies, therefore we are opening a forum for friends who will continue further studies in the fields of nursing and physiotherapy through the RPL program, as for the Masters program “Nursing and Medical Surgical Nursing Specialist,” he explained
New Student Admissions for the RPL Program which is a transfer from D3 Nursing and D3 Physiotherapy, Masters in Nursing, and Medical Surgical Nursing Specialists which are expected to open in mid-February 2024 for the Early Semester of 2024/2025.
